Roman Reigns emerged victorious in the 2026 Men’s Royal Rumble, held in Saudi Arabia, securing a title shot at WrestleMania 42. This victory marks a record 11th main event appearance for Reigns at WWE’s biggest stage.
In the final moments of the Rumble, Reigns faced off against Gunther, who had just eliminated AJ Styles. Reigns clinched the win with a spear that sent Gunther tumbling over the top rope.
Reigns has the choice to challenge either Drew McIntyre for the Undisputed WWE Championship or CM Punk for the World Heavyweight Championship at WrestleMania, set for April 18–19.
Oba Femi made an impressive debut by entering the ring at No. 1 and eliminating five opponents before being taken out by Brock Lesnar. Femi lasted an impressive 39 minutes, showcasing his potential as a future star in the WWE.
The Rumble featured exciting moments, including the return of LA Knight and a surprise appearance by Royce Keys, formerly known as Powerhouse Hobbs in AEW.
Notably, Cody Rhodes was eliminated in an unexpected twist when McIntyre struck him from outside the ring. The event was packed with established stars and newcomers, creating a thrilling atmosphere for fans.
Both Reigns and Rhodes were favorites heading into the match. Rhodes aimed to join the ranks of legends like “Stone Cold” Steve Austin by winning his third Rumble. Meanwhile, several rising stars like Gunther and Bron Breakker showcased their skills, adding depth to the competition.
